BPK 113Y is a 1983 Lotus Esprit in Silver with a 2,174c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 93.3%.
Across all 1983 Lotus Esprit models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.1% with a typical mileage of 59,354 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Lotus Esprit f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 624 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BPK 113Y,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lotus Esprit typically stays on UK roads for around 50 years. At 43 years old, this Lotus Esprit is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
